Spread

A A3 is not one car.

The slowest in this sample makes 53.7 kW per tonne and the quickest 112.2 — a factor of 2.1 between two cars wearing the same badge. Any single number for a A3 is an average over that.

Method

Where these numbers come from.

SourceRDW open data: the vehicle register and the fuel table carrying net maximum power, joined per vehicle.
Sample300 Audi A3s drawn from five spread windows across the 96,605 registered, because reading the register in stored order returns clumps of one variant. The figures above are that sample, not a census — treat the median as reliable and the extremes as indicative.
Who is left out73 of the sample are hybrids. Neither is in the figures above: for both, the register records a power figure that is not what the car accelerates on.
The 0–100Integrated from power, mass and drag: traction-limited then power-limited, with a torque interruption for anything with gears. Checked against 18 cars with published factory figures, 7.6% mean error. It does not know which wheels are driven, because the register does not record it.
